Alexander Debelov was Appointed as Chief Executive Officer at Virool

Date of management change: March 15, 2012 

What Happened?

San Francisco, CA-based Virool Appointed Alexander Debelov as Chief Executive Officer

 

About the Company

Virool is a leading video distribution platform that allows anyone to promote a video hosted on YouTube. Virool has already helped thousands of video ad campaigns from companies including Turkish Airlines, Intel, Sony, Coca-Cola, Samsung, Anheuser Busch and Mitsubishi. Virool ActivView products are designed to drive engagement and go beyond the view. Founded in 2012, Virool leverages a growing network of more than 35,000 publishers across websites, blogs, social networks and mobile applications. To date, the company has raised $6.62M in seed funding from a collection of top VC firms and angel investors. It is the biggest seed investment that any Y-Combinator graduate has ever received.

 

About the Person

Alexander Debelov is a serial entrepreneur, previously being a co-founder of the Kairos Society, the world`s largest student entrepreneurship organization, and Crelligence Media, award winning marketing company. He is currently co-founder of Virool, a game changing online video advertising platform.
